Explain the difference between MNC and Transnational Corporations

Evaluate responses using AI:

OFF

Answer explanation

Decision making

Decision making in a multinational is made in the mother country and should be effected in all the subsidiaries globally. On the other hand, decision making in a transnational is made by individual transnational corporations.

Local markets

Multinationals face restrictions when it comes to local markets since they have centralized management systems. On the other hand, transnational companies are free to make decisions independently based on local markets.
